What Exactly is VR Pilates?
VR Pilates refers to the practice of Pilates exercises within a virtual reality environment. It typically involves wearing a VR headset, which transports the user into a digital space where a virtual instructor or interactive program guides them through a sequence of movements.
- Core Concept: The fundamental principles of Pilates – centering, concentration, control, precision, breath, and flow – remain at the heart of VR Pilates. The VR platform serves as the medium for instruction and feedback, rather than altering the essence of the exercise itself.
- How it Works:
- Hardware: Users require a VR headset (e.g., Meta Quest, Pico, HTC Vive) and often controllers to interact with the virtual environment. Some advanced systems may incorporate full-body tracking for more precise movement analysis.
- Software: Dedicated VR Pilates applications or broader fitness platforms offering Pilates modules provide the content. These programs feature virtual instructors, visual cues, and sometimes auditory feedback to guide the user.
- Interaction: The user follows the movements of the virtual instructor, often with on-screen indicators or voice commands. Some applications utilize the VR controller to track limb positions, offering basic feedback on alignment or range of motion.
Benefits of VR Pilates: A Scientific Perspective
Integrating VR technology into Pilates offers several distinct advantages, rooted in accessibility, engagement, and potential for personalized feedback.
- Accessibility and Convenience: VR Pilates removes geographical barriers and time constraints associated with traditional studios. It allows individuals to practice Pilates anywhere with sufficient space, at any time, making consistent adherence to a fitness regimen more achievable. This is particularly beneficial for those in remote areas or with demanding schedules.
- Enhanced Engagement and Motivation: The immersive nature of VR can significantly boost user engagement. The novelty and interactive elements can make workouts feel less like a chore and more like an enjoyable experience, potentially increasing motivation and adherence to an exercise program. Visualizations of progress or gamified elements can further reinforce positive habits.
- Real-time Feedback and Form Correction (Potential): While still evolving, advanced VR systems have the potential to offer sophisticated real-time feedback. By tracking body movements through sensors, applications could theoretically identify deviations from proper form and provide immediate visual or auditory corrections, akin to a virtual instructor. This could be invaluable for preventing injury and maximizing exercise effectiveness.
- Spatial Awareness and Proprioception: Engaging with a virtual environment requires users to be acutely aware of their body's position in space relative to virtual objects. This can subtly enhance proprioception (the body's sense of its position and movement) and spatial awareness, which are integral components of Pilates practice.
- Supplement to Traditional Pilates: For experienced practitioners, VR Pilates can serve as an excellent way to maintain consistency between studio sessions or to explore new sequences and variations in a self-paced environment.
Limitations and Considerations
Despite its promise, VR Pilates comes with its own set of limitations that users should be aware of.
- Lack of Tactile Feedback: A significant drawback is the absence of tactile feedback that a live instructor provides. An in-person trainer can physically adjust a client's posture, provide resistance, or offer support, which is crucial for deep kinesthetic learning and fine-tuning form, especially in mat and reformer Pilates.
- Equipment Requirements and Cost: Entry into VR Pilates requires an initial investment in a VR headset and potentially subscription fees for premium content. This can be a barrier for some individuals compared to free online videos or basic gym memberships.
- Motion Sickness and Disorientation: Some users may experience motion sickness, dizziness, or disorientation when using VR headsets, particularly during initial sessions or with certain types of visual movement. This can interrupt workouts and deter consistent use.
- Supervision for Beginners: For individuals new to Pilates, starting with VR without any prior instruction from a qualified human trainer carries risks. Incorrect form can lead to ineffective workouts or, worse, injury. A foundational understanding of Pilates principles and proper movement mechanics is highly recommended before relying solely on VR instruction.
- Program Quality Variability: As with any digital content, the quality of VR Pilates applications can vary widely. Some programs may offer excellent instruction and user experience, while others may be less effective or biomechanically sound.

Integrating VR Pilates into Your Fitness Routine
If you're considering incorporating VR Pilates, here are some practical recommendations:
- Start Gradually: Begin with shorter sessions to acclimate to the VR environment and the movements. Pay attention to how your body responds and increase duration and intensity progressively.
- Prioritize Proper Form: If you are new to Pilates, consider attending a few in-person sessions with a certified instructor first to learn the foundational principles and proper form. Even with VR, regularly check your alignment in a mirror if possible, and be mindful of your body's sensations.
- Consider a Hybrid Approach: The most effective strategy for many might be a hybrid model, combining VR Pilates with occasional in-person classes or check-ins with a qualified instructor. This allows for personalized feedback while leveraging the convenience of VR.
- Listen to Your Body: Always pay attention to any discomfort or pain. VR, while immersive, cannot replace your internal kinesthetic awareness. Modify exercises as needed or take breaks if you feel fatigued or experience discomfort.
